The correct answer is that the Texas House issued arrest warrants to the Democrats who fled the state. This action was a response to a significant political impasse in which a number of Democratic lawmakers left Texas to prevent a quorum during a contentious legislative session. The House sought to compel their return in order to conduct business and vote on pending legislation.

Issuing arrest warrants indicates a severe measure taken by the legislature to enforce attendance and underscores the intensity of the political struggle at that time. The use of arrest warrants illustrates the lengths to which the majority party was willing to go to ensure they could carry out their legislative agenda.
